Located in the growing community of Apremdu, Saint Barnabas’ Anglican Church is a devoted and vibrant parish within the Diocese of Sekondi. Named after Saint Barnabas — known in the New Testament as the “Son of Encouragement” — our church seeks to embody that same spirit of hope, generosity, and fellowship in all we do.
Rooted in the Anglican tradition and nourished by Word and Sacrament, Saint Barnabas’ is a spiritual home where people of all ages and backgrounds are welcomed, nurtured, and sent out in mission. We value reverent worship, strong community, and a commitment to living out our faith in daily life.
